Transaction 510504835520d1f7c7ac32ea51a78dd1e30ab8c4b5aef9ac83059c1c607b7243
1 Input
2 Outputs
- 510504835520d1f7c7ac32ea51a78dd1e30ab8c4b5aef9ac83059c1c607b7243:0
- 510504835520d1f7c7ac32ea51a78dd1e30ab8c4b5aef9ac83059c1c607b7243:1
value 993325
address 1Jwtjcow5MeLfoHEdeXDBzCcLHt1fcu5jg
value 1000000
address 34px6Z1zjDBcA2zHYhsvovm2BLgmLtm7oL